I was in the market for a car when a friend of mine suggested that I try the Sorento. I was so glad I did!! This SUV is as awesome as the title says. This venicle has been off-road and on the city streets of Chicago. If any of you know about the highways in Chicago, you know they're almost as bad as going off-road. However, I've hit potholes, roadkill, branches, DEEP standing water (that's really cool), curbs, etc. and there's absolutely no rattling in the car. NONE!! I've got close to 23,000 miles on my EX and except for the gas mileage, I've found nothing wrong with it!

I had nothing but problems from the time I bought my Kia brand new. Crack in the drive shaft with less than 300 miles on it a month after I bought it. Constant electrical problems that the dealer couldn't fix: brake lights out every 3 months, headlights out every 6 months. Both headlights blew out at the same time once! $400+ to replace sensors, including throttle and airbag, which warranty had just expired (conveniently). Bad catalytic converter, which went bad 2K miles after warranty expired. This is the WORST purchase of my life. The only reason I didn't get rid of it sooner was because I was STUCK with it: they depreciate too fast you can't trade them in. PLANNED OBSOLESCENCE @ its best!
